Etsy is a site where crafters and people who like crafts (but can't make them, like me) can buy and sell handmade items. There is something for everyone. It is a well-organized site with beautiful stuff priced very reasonably. They have absolutely gorgeous original art and in my quick perusal I didn't see one piece for more than $60. The handbags were great fun and inexpensive too.
